Africa Tech Festival 2025 Advances Ethical AI Frameworks to Promote Responsible Innovation
The Africa Tech Festival 2025 has positioned itself at the forefront of Responsible Innovation with a strong emphasis on ethical artificial intelligence (AI). This year’s discussions are centered around creating robust frameworks that prioritize transparency, accountability, and inclusivity across all technological developments. Key stakeholders, including policymakers, technologists, and community leaders, convened to explore strategies for ensuring that AI systems are not only efficient but also equitable. The festival emphasizes the importance of collaboration among a diverse set of voices to shape the future of technology on the continent.
Attendees engaged in panels highlighting the role of ethical AI in driving sustainable growth and fostering inclusive investment. Topics of discussion included:
- Balancing innovation with ethical considerations
- Leveraging AI for socioeconomic development
- Creating standards for responsible AI deployment
In addition, a dedicated session featured a transparent table outlining current AI initiatives across African nations aimed at promoting ethical standards:
| Country | AI Initiative | Focus Area |
|---|---|---|
| Kenya | AI for Agriculture | Food Security |
| South Africa | Data Governance Framework | Transparency |
| Nigeria | Inclusive Tech Hub | Start-up Support |
Inclusive Investment Strategies to Empower Africa’s Tech Ecosystem
As Africa’s tech landscape rapidly evolves, investment strategies are increasingly shifting towards inclusivity to harness the continent’s full potential. Ethical considerations are at the forefront, ensuring that investments not only yield financial returns but also foster sustainable development. Key initiatives are focused on enhancing accessibility for underrepresented communities, including women and youth, who play a vital role in the tech ecosystem. This shift is supported by several stakeholders:
- Venture Capital Firms: Committing to funding diverse portfolios that prioritize startups led by marginalized founders.
- Government Policies: Implementing regulations that incentivize equitable investment practices and promote local entrepreneurship.
- NGOs and Nonprofits: Offering mentorship and resources to emerging tech leaders from various backgrounds.
Additionally, platforms promoting collaborative efforts among various sectors are paramount. Investors are encouraged to adopt models that emphasize not just profit but also social impact, creating a ripple effect throughout the community. A focused approach can include:
| Focus Area | Strategy |
|---|---|
| Skills Development | Investing in training programs for tech skills in underserved regions. |
| Infrastructure | Funding projects that provide technology access in rural areas. |
| Circular Economy | Supporting startups that promote sustainable technology practices. |
By implementing these inclusive investment strategies, stakeholders can effectively empower Africa’s tech ecosystem, paving the way for innovation and growth that is both ethical and sustainable.
